Consultation on changes to hospital services in North Kirklees and

Wakefield District

Pontefract public meeting – 16 May 2013

Process for tonight’s meeting• Short presentation summarising the changes proposed and

their impact on services for Pontefract residents

• ‘Question Time’ style session led by independent Chairman – Steve Richards

15 minutes on maternity services

15 minutes on inpatient paediatrics

15 minutes on emergency care

15 minutes on surgery

Remainder of time left on any other issues

The basis for consultation

We are consulting on changes in secondary care across North Kirklees and Wakefield District – specifically:

• Surgery• Inpatient children’s services• Maternity services• Emergency care

• Greater demands – people living longer, more long-term illness

• Things have changed – more specialisation, more care away from hospitals

• Doing things differently will save more lives and give patients better outcomes:o bringing specialists together saves more lives and gives better clinical

outcomes for patients

o separating planned and unplanned surgery means fewer cancelled operations and the most critically ill patients are treated quickly by specialists

PROPOSED CHANGES TO HOSPITAL SERVICES

Pontefract no change: midwife-led unit‘low risk’: home, midwife unit or Pinderfields‘high risk’: deliver at Pinderfields

Pinderfields ‘high risk’ births: all to consultant-led unit‘low risk’ births: home, midwife-led unit

Dewsbury midwife-led unit‘low risk’ : home, midwife unit or Pinderfields‘high risk’: deliver at Pinderfields

Local antenatal/postnatal care

Maternity services – proposed changes

Pontefract : no change

Pinderfields: no change

Dewsbury: inpatient care at Pinderfields

Urgent assessment & outpatients at all 3 hospitals

New children’s assessment service at Dewsbury

Inpatient children’s services

Emergency care

Pinderfields• specialist trauma and emergency care centre for Mid Yorkshire• continues to see full range of cases • centre for emergencies needing inpatient care

Pontefract• as now, open access for emergency care• full resuscitation facilities • able to treat a wide range of conditions • some ambulance attendances• consultant presence during the day and on call 24/7• development of new Emergency Day Care centre

SurgeryPontefract • Planned orthopaedics, ophthalmology (from 2013)• Range of inpatient short stay surgery• Day surgery

Pinderfields • Emergency surgery, complex surgery (critical care)• Day surgeryDewsbury • Planned inpatient surgery (more specialties)• Day surgery • Some unplanned surgery

The future for Pontefract under these proposals• As now, A&E open access with the most serious A&E

cases still taken to specialist centre at Pinderfields• The Clinical Decisions Unit would stay with step up/step

down beds• Development of Emergency Day Care centre• Range of planned inpatient surgery – inc orthopaedics

and ophthalmology• Outpatient appointments• As now, midwife led maternity unit remains• As now, all antenatal and postnatal care

Next steps• Consultation closes 31 May• Analysis of consultation output and final report

produced by independent experts• Report considered by other partner organisations at

major event 2 July• Report with recommendations from 2 July event

considered by the boards of NHS North Kirklees and Wakefield CCGs on 25 July when a decision will be taken
